Transaction

cfec894975686a64ca6020e1322177f2b9f3ceca0bcf04437370c32720918457

Summary

In Block856557
TimeThu, 05 Sep 2024 02:54:15 UTC
Total Input25326.7 Nebula
Total Output25347.7 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
113499 Confirmations25347.7 Nebula
Raw Transaction